Alumni Spotlight: Sahil Bansal

Photos

Sahil is from India and currently studying at the University of Liverpool in England. He is 20 years old and pursing a bachelors degree in BA Business Studies.

How has this experience impacted your future?

This experience has given a sense of working in the real world that will be very useful in future. An overview was gained of how each department of a five star hotel operates to make sure their guests enjoy the best possible experience. Moreover a lot was learned about working in the Sales and Marketing department and experiencing different techniques to get new/repeat business for the Hotel.
